What is the Exam?

The Common Admission Test (CAT) is India’s premier computer-based management entrance examination conducted annually by the Indian Institutes of Management (IIMs) on a rotational basis. It serves as the primary gateway for admission into prestigious Post Graduate Programs in Management (MBA/PGDM) across 21 IIMs, Faculty of Management Studies (FMS) Delhi, SPJIMR Mumbai, XLRI (accepting CAT scores for specific programs), Management Development Institute (MDI) Gurgaon, and IIT Department of Management Studies (DoMS).

We at Exam Bhai understand that CAT is not merely a test of knowledge; it is a rigorous assessment of an aspirant's data interpretation skills, logical reasoning capacities, linguistic competence, mathematical precision, and, most importantly, strategic time management under pressure. The exam is typically administered on the last Sunday of November in three distinct slots: morning, afternoon, and evening. Key Highlights 2026

Navigating the management entrance landscape requires staying updated with the absolute latest structural metrics. Below are the key structural and operational highlights for the upcoming examination cycle:

  • Conducting Institute: Alternating among the top IIMs (IIM Bangalore, IIM Ahmedabad, or IIM Calcutta design the framework).
  • Exam Mode: Computer-Based Test (CBT) administered across designated national test centers.
  • Total Test Slots: 3 distinct sessions (Slot 1: 8:30 AM - 10:30 AM, Slot 2: 12:30 PM - 2:30 PM, Slot 3: 4:30 PM - 6:30 PM).
  • Total Questions: 66 Questions across three core sections.
  • Testing Windows: Exactly 120 minutes total, with strict 40-minute sectional time limits.
  • Language of Test: Exclusively English.
  • Score Validity: Academic Year 2027-2028 intake only.

Syllabus 2026

The CAT examination does not have a rigid, pre-defined institutional syllabus published by the IIMs. However, based on deep analytical review of past decades' papers, we at Exam Bhai have mapped out the exhaustive topics you must master.

Section NameCore ModulesHigh-Weightage Topics
Verbal Ability & Reading Comprehension (VARC)Reading Comprehension, Verbal AbilityCritical Reasoning, Inference-based RC Passages, Para Jumbles, Paragraph Summary, Odd-One-Out sentences.
Data Interpretation & Logical Reasoning (DILR)Data Interpretation, Logical ReasoningCaselets, Tables, Bar Graphs, Pie Charts, Arrangements (Linear & Circular), Matrix Grids, Games & Tournaments, Venn Diagrams (3 & 4 Variables), Cubes, Network Routes.
Quantitative Aptitude (QA)Number Systems, Algebra, Arithmetic, Geometry, Modern MathPercentages, Profit & Loss, Simple & Compound Interest, Time-Speed-Distance, Linear & Quadratic Equations, Functions & Graphs, Progressions ($AP, GP$), Triangles, Coordinate Geometry, Permutations & Combinations, Probability.

Marking Scheme Details

  • Correct Attempt: $+3$ marks.
  • Incorrect MCQ Attempt: $-1$ mark.
  • Incorrect Non-MCQ (TITA - Type In The Answer) Attempt: $0$ marks (No negative penalization).

Eligibility Criteria

Before downloading the detailed schedule tracker, ensure you satisfy the rigorous operational compliance metrics laid down by the testing authority. As verified via official statutory declarations on national advisory resources and the official portal updates maintained by regulatory frameworks at iimcat.ac.in:

  • Academic Qualification: The candidate must hold a Bachelor’s Degree, or equivalent qualification, awarded by any University incorporated by an act of the central or state legislature in India.
  • Minimum Marks Requirement: General, EWS, and NC-OBC candidates must secure a minimum of $50%$ aggregate marks or equivalent CGPA. For Scheduled Caste (SC), Scheduled Tribe (ST), and Persons with Disabilities (PwD) categories, the minimum requirement drops to $45%$.
  • Final Year Candidates: Candidates appearing for the final year of their bachelor’s degree/equivalent qualification examination, or those who have completed degree requirements and are awaiting results, are fully eligible to apply provisionally.
  • Professional Qualifications: Candidates possessing professional degrees like CA, CS, or ICWA meeting the minimum percentage baselines are also completely eligible.

Application Process

The application portal is completely digital and operates over a fixed window from early August to mid-September. Follow this structured roadmap to execute an error-free registration process:

  1. Registration for Credentials: Visit the official portal (iimcat.ac.in) and click on 'New Candidate Registration' to obtain your unique User ID and Password via SMS and Email.
  2. Filling Personal & Academic Details: Log in to input your personal information, address details, and comprehensive academic history ranging from Class 10th, Class 12th, Bachelor's Degree tracking, to additional professional certifications.
  3. Work Experience Entries: Provide precise start and end dates of full-time post-graduation employment. Part-time jobs, internships, or articleships are strictly excluded.
  4. Program Selection: Select your preferred IIM campuses and specific programs (e.g., PGP, PGP-HRM, PGP-FABM) along with interview cities.
  5. Document Uploadation: Upload high-resolution scanned copies of passports-sized photographs, digital signatures, and category validation certificates (SC/ST/OBC/PwD) matching exact sizing specifications.
  6. Application Fee Payment: Remit the non-refundable registration processing fee online via Net Banking, Credit Cards, or UPI options.

The 8-Month Daily Preparation Framework

  • Phase 1: Concept Building & Foundations (Months 1 to 4)

    • Daily Slot 1 (Morning - 2 Hours): Focus on Quantitative Aptitude fundamentals. Cover Arithmetic, Number Systems, and foundational Algebra equations. Avoid short-cuts early on; prioritize mastering core concepts.
    • Daily Slot 2 (Afternoon - 1.5 Hours): Dedicate this time to VARC text reading. Read editorials from The Hindu, The Guardian, and Aeon Essays to build a reading speed of around 250-300 words per minute.
    • Daily Slot 3 (Evening - 2 Hours): Solve 2 sets of Data Interpretation basics (tables, bar charts) and 2 sets of basic analytical arrangements.
  • Phase 2: Advanced Sectional Drills & Rigorous Testing (Months 5 to 6)

    • Daily Slot 1 (2 Hours): Solve mixed variable quantitative worksheets ($QA$) focusing on Geometry and Modern Mathematics.
    • Daily Slot 2 (2 Hours): Transition to timed sectional tests. Solve 4 complex Reading Comprehension passages and 8 Verbal Ability questions under a strict 40-minute timer.
    • Daily Slot 3 (2 Hours): Tackle advanced DILR problem matrices, focusing on complex games, tournaments, and multi-variable Venn diagrams.
  • Phase 3: Mock Intensification & Strategic Revision (Months 7 to 8)

    • Daily Routine: Shift your main focus to full-length testing. Take a full exam block during your assigned slot time (Morning, Afternoon, or Evening).
    • Post-Mock Analysis (3 Hours): Spend double the test duration analyzing errors, unattempted items, and looking for faster alternative methods.
    • Daily Revision Tracker (1 Hour): Review your personalized "Error Logbook" to ensure you don't repeat the same conceptual mistakes.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q1: Can an average student crack CAT 2026 with a 99+ percentile using a daily schedule?

Yes, absolute consistency trumps past academic scores when it comes to the CAT exam. By strictly adhering to a structured 5-6 hour daily routine that balances concept building with rigorous mock test analysis, anyone can develop the required logical skills to achieve a 99+ percentile.

Q2: How many months are ideally required to complete the entire CAT preparation syllabus?

An ideal preparation window spans 6 to 8 months. The first 4 months focus on building clear conceptual foundations across VARC, DILR, and QA. The remaining months are dedicated to advanced application, sectional testing, speed building, and full-length mock strategies.

Q3: Is there a specific sectional cut-off requirement to get calls from top IIMs?

Yes, the top-tier IIMs enforce strict sectional cut-offs alongside their overall percentile requirements. Even if you score a $99.9$ overall percentile, failing to meet the minimum sectional threshold (typically $80% - 85%$) in any one section can disqualify you from receiving an interview call.

Q4: How should a working professional structure their daily study schedule?

Working professionals should aim for a split schedule: 2 hours in the early morning before work for focused concept study (like Quantitative Aptitude), and 2 hours at night for practice sets (like Reading Comprehension and DILR). On weekends, dedicate 6-8 hours to full-length mock tests and comprehensive analysis.

Q5: What is the negative marking policy for the Type In The Answer (TITA) questions?

TITA questions do not carry any negative marking penalties. If your typed answer is incorrect, your score for that question is simply zero. Therefore, we highly recommend attempting all TITA questions across all sections.

Q6: How many mock tests should I take before the actual exam?

We recommend taking between 25 and 35 full-length mock tests. Start with bi-weekly mocks during your foundation phase, and ramp up to 2-3 mocks per week in the final two months leading up to the exam. Always ensure you thoroughly analyze each mock before moving on to the next one.
